Sometimes design comes in the form of reusing old and retro products that nobody wants anymore. Here, Transparent House Inc. has created the Tape Lamp, which is a very unique table lamp which makes use of a laser cut plexi glass and a hundred translucent micro-cassettes. The bulb type used for the lamp is a 40 Watt Vida Large G-16.5 Globe. The Tape Lamp is priced at a hefty $1200, with a shipping price of $35. Then again, it does look good.
